aramean

Estimated CEFR level: C2 — Proficiency

Estimated from word frequency; not an official CEFR classification.

Definition

  1. noun a member of one of a group of Semitic peoples inhabiting Aram and parts of Mesopotamia from the 11th to the 8th century BC
  2. adjective of or relating to Aram or to its inhabitants or their culture or their language

Synonyms

Aramaean

Semantic network

Broader (hypernyms)
semite
